Located in Stowe, the number one destination in Vermont, the Timberholm Inn is a historic Vermont ski lodge. The Timberholm Inn sits on four acres of wooded hillside with spectacular views of Vermont's Green Mountains.

We host weddings year round. In warmer weather, weddings in our garden overlooking the mountains can accommodate up to 100 guests.

In the colder months, our wedding couples can choose to marry in our beautiful wood paneled great room in front of our large flagstone fireplace.

We work with you to provide everything you need for your small intimate wedding with just you and your partner, or, if you are planning a grander affair, we will help you with everything from the perfect caterer to the justice of the peace.

We know chefs, catering companies, florists, photographers, musicians, wedding planners, justices of the peace, ministers, wedding attire specialists, or anybody else in our community that you might need to make your wedding special.

You and your guests can rent the entire Inn for a weekend, or a week. Many couples choose to rent the whole place, which can sleep up to 22 guests in 9 rooms. Each room or suite has a private bath and unique artisanal furniture made by local craftsmen and decorated in a Vermont ski lodge style.

We use only the highest quality linens on the beds and there is a comforter at the foot of each bed for napping.

We serve large three-course country award winning breakfasts from fresh, local ingredients.

Tom serves tea, cocoa and baked goodies every afternoon in the great room. If you or a guest has dietary restrictions we will happily accommodate them.

Stowe is the premier downhill ski destination in the east as well as a world-class destination for cross-country skiing, hiking, mountain biking and cycling. It is a quintessential New England village with some of the best restaurants, spas, art galleries and shopping to be found anywhere.

You and your guests can go kayaking, snowshoeing, dogsledding, hiking or even zip-lining. No matter the time of year there is always something to do in Stowe.

Vermont is New England's most gay-friendly state. We were the first state to legalize same sex marriage via legislation and we are proud of that fact. Most other states found their way to legalization by court order. Vermont voters chose to legalize same sex marriage by an overwhelming majority.
